Peter WYLIE was born in 1711 in Antrim, Antrim, Ireland, the child of Adam Wylie And Jean Horner Wylie. Peter WYLIE married Anne Annie Hawthorne Wylie, and had children including Frank Wylie, James Wylie, Margaret Boyd, William Wylie. Peter WYLIE passed away in 1795 in Chester, Chester County, South Carolina, United States of America.
